Meditation: LA0967-Division and Oneness

Yogi Bhajan – LA0967 – April 12, 2001

MEDITATION – Division and Oneness
1. Sit straight in a cross-legged position. Raise both hands to shoulder level with the elbows relaxed down. Point the index fingers up and the other fingers curled down with thumbs covering them. Eyes are closed.

Meditation: Know the Psyche of the Other

Yogi Bhajan – unknown date

Grasp the left thumb with the right hand, and place the  hands on your lap.  Close your eyes. After a few moments, feel the sensation of your nose becoming inverted, So that the tip of your nose is between the eyes, and the bridge of the nose is at the bottom.

Today: Nourish Wisely – from the I Ching

Nurture others in need, as if you were feeding yourself.
Take care not to provide sustenance for those who feed off others.  In bestowing care and nourishment, it is important that the right people should be taken care of and that we should attend to our own nourishment in the right way. If we wish to know what anyone is like, we have only to observe on whom he bestows his care and what sides of his own nature he cultivates and nourishes.
